Transformers: Zone (トランスフォーマーZ) is a Japanese Transformers franchise from 1990. The waning popularity of Transformers became evident with the advent of the Zone franchise, which received very little of the traditional media support.
The Zone franchise featured the following primary components:
- Toys released under the original Fight! Super Robot Lifeform Transformers branding
- A one-episode OVA
- One chapter of manga telling the same story as the OVA
- A series of story pages published in TV Magazine
